[Qemu-devel] [PATCH 09/17] pc.c: remove a global variable, RTCState *rtc


From: Isaku Yamahata
Subject: [Qemu-devel] [PATCH 09/17] pc.c: remove a global variable, RTCState *rtc_state.
Date: Fri, 17 Jul 2009 16:22:57 +0900

remove a global variable, RTCState *rtc_state.
Only the cmos_set_s3_resume_init() needs it global.
So introduce a registering function and make it local.
As for other function which references the variable, pass it
as a function argument.
